C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2023 in Review

1,671 of the 6,859 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Citigroup (C) for Q4 2023, worth a combined $72.4B — up 29% from $55.9B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 282 funds opened new C positions and 110 closed out — a net gain of 172 holders — while 539 added to existing stakes and 683 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Morgan Stanley, adding an estimated $1.43B. The largest seller was Susquehanna International Group, cutting an estimated $291M.
